We needn't keep this hypothetical.  ViewVC is using (a slightly
modified[*]) Python ConfigParser in this way.

-- Mike

[*] By default, ConfigParser (well, really the RawConfigParser it
subclasses) lowercases option names, which can cause username/group
matching to fail.  So ViewVC's code replaces the optionxform method of
ConfigParser with a noop lambda function.  (See
https://docs.python.org/2/library/configparser.html#ConfigParser.RawConfigParser.optionxform
for official docs.)
